/**
* Plan tests for {@link AddExchangesForSingleNodeExecution}.
* Verifies that filter predicates are properly pushed into system table scans
* and that exchanges are correctly placed in single-node execution mode.
*/
public class TestAddExchangesForSingleNodeExecution
extends BasePlanTest
{
private Session singleNodeSession()
{
return Session.builder(getQueryRunner().getDefaultSession())
.setSystemProperty(SINGLE_NODE_EXECUTION_ENABLED, "true")
.build();
}

private Plan planSingleNode(String query)
{
return plan(singleNodeSession(), query, Optimizer.PlanStage.OPTIMIZED_AND_VALIDATED, false);
}

@Test
public void testShowColumnsHasGatherExchange()
{
// SHOW COLUMNS is rewritten to a query against information_schema.columns (system table).
// In single-node mode, system table scans must have a GATHER exchange.
Plan plan = planSingleNode("SHOW COLUMNS FROM orders");

assertTrue(hasGatherExchange(plan),
"Single-node plan for SHOW COLUMNS should contain a GATHER exchange");
}

@Test
public void testDescribeHasGatherExchange()
{
// DESCRIBE is an alias for SHOW COLUMNS
Plan plan = planSingleNode("DESCRIBE orders");

assertTrue(hasGatherExchange(plan),
"Single-node plan for DESCRIBE should contain a GATHER exchange");
}

@Test
public void testShowColumnsFilterNotAboveExchange()
{
// After the visitFilter fix, the filter predicate (table_name = 'orders') should be
// pushed into the TableScanNode, so any remaining FilterNode should be BELOW the
// GATHER exchange, not above it. This verifies the predicate flows through the
// native worker path (exchange → scan with pushed predicate).
Plan plan = planSingleNode("SHOW COLUMNS FROM orders");

boolean hasFilterAboveExchange = searchFrom(plan.getRoot())
.where(node -> node instanceof FilterNode &&
node.getSources().stream().anyMatch(source -> source instanceof ExchangeNode))
.findFirst()
.isPresent();

assertFalse(hasFilterAboveExchange,
"FilterNode should not appear above the GATHER exchange; predicate should be pushed into the scan below the exchange");
}

@Test
public void testRegularTableScanNoExchangeAdded()
{
// For regular (non-system) tables, no remote exchange should be added
// by AddExchangesForSingleNodeExecution
Plan plan = planSingleNode("SELECT nationkey, name FROM nation WHERE nationkey > 5");

boolean hasRemoteExchange = searchFrom(plan.getRoot())
.where(node -> node instanceof ExchangeNode &&
((ExchangeNode) node).getScope() == REMOTE_STREAMING)
.findFirst()
.isPresent();

assertFalse(hasRemoteExchange,
"Regular table scan in single-node mode should not have remote exchanges");
}

@Test
public void testRegularFilterNotAffected()
{
// A filter on a regular (non-system) table should remain unchanged
// (visitFilter falls through to default rewrite)
Plan plan = planSingleNode("SELECT nationkey FROM nation WHERE nationkey > 10");

boolean hasTableScan = searchFrom(plan.getRoot())
.where(node -> node instanceof TableScanNode)
.findFirst()
.isPresent();

assertTrue(hasTableScan,
"Regular table query should still have a TableScanNode");
}

private boolean hasGatherExchange(Plan plan)
{
return searchFrom(plan.getRoot())
.where(node -> node instanceof ExchangeNode &&
((ExchangeNode) node).getType() == GATHER &&
((ExchangeNode) node).getScope() == REMOTE_STREAMING)
.findFirst()
.isPresent();
}
}
